Transaction 8613888a582ac9f98f3817f127bbbb8207580bd863699426f8bbad2098db7f62
1 Input
1 Output
-
8613888a582ac9f98f3817f127bbbb8207580bd863699426f8bbad2098db7f62:0
- value
- 527570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fbaec8ac99f9c62fb2e5ad82ff21d028a7053d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16oyVnwMqCD8v7uyPpKX3ReyHfCwTxD2DF